About the Role
We are interested in speaking with Senior Analyst and Associate level candidates who currently work in investment banking for future potential opportunities within our growing team.
Based in Hong Kong, as a Senior Analyst / Associate you will be expected to focus on advanced financial modeling and provide all-round transaction support to senior and experienced professionals who will encourage you to go beyond the numbers and think creatively.
Responsibilities
- Managing day-to-day execution for M&A and capital markets transactions
- Financial modelling, financial and industry analysis
- Preparation of external marketing materials and internal reporting documents
Qualifications / Skills Required
- A university degree (or equivalent) in Finance or related disciplines with excellent academic results
- At least 2 years of hands-on investment banking experience in deal or transaction support
- Strong analytical and numerical skills (financial modeling)
- Excellent oral and written communication skills are essential
- A positive, highly motivated individual who exhibits strong leadership and management qualities
- Strong team player who is able to work effectively in a team environment
